Azerbaijani President Ilham Aliyev received senior security officials from member states of the Organization of Turkic States (OTS) on September 17. The meeting took place in Baku with representatives from Azerbaijan, Uzbekistan, Kazakhstan, Kyrgyzstan, Türkiye and the Turkish Republic of Northern Cyprus.

Participants included Azerbaijani Security Council Secretary Ramil Usubov, OTS Secretary General Kubanychbek Omuraliev, Secretary General of Türkiye’s National Security Council Okay Memiş, Secretary of the Security Council under the President of Uzbekistan Viktor Makhmudov, Kyrgyz Security Council Secretary Adilet Orozbekov, Deputy Chair of Kazakhstan’s Security Council Aida Balayeva and adviser to the Prime Minister of the Turkish Republic of Northern Cyprus Mehmet Ağa.

Addressing the meeting, Aliyev said the Organization of Turkic States has “very high international authority.” According to him, the OTS agenda includes international security, trade, transport, multiculturalism and humanitarian cooperation.

The Azerbaijani president said member states have significant potential and are committed to strengthening the organization’s role on the international stage. “The potential of our countries is substantial and continues to grow stronger,” he said.

Aliyev also highlighted the importance of energy security, saying it has become especially significant in the current international environment. He noted that the natural resources of OTS countries contribute to strengthening their economies, improving public welfare and supporting global energy security.

The president added that Azerbaijan has established joint investment funds with Kazakhstan, Uzbekistan and Kyrgyzstan, describing mutual investment mobilization as an active process.

“The Turkic world is our family, and we have no other family,” Aliyev said, calling cooperation with Turkic states Azerbaijan’s main foreign policy priority.
